## Runbook: Payment Retry Idempotency (Ledgerly)

Quick refresher for the sync: every payment retry in Ledgerly now carries an idempotency key derived from the order hash, so double-charges from flaky network retries should be gone. When cutting a release, run the replay harness against the staging processor and confirm zero duplicate captures — the dashboard should show a flat dupe count. Once that's green, tag the build and push to the Fenmore registry. The release bundle gets signed with the key that follows.

signing key of fahag-tadug = bky9_XH2KCQnPM

The Hueguard audit endpoint evaluates rendered pages for color-contrast failures against the Lumenline accessibility baseline and returns a per-element report with severity tiers. Release managers should run the audit against the staging build before sign-off; the pipeline will block promotion if any critical-tier failures remain unresolved. Batch audits are queued through the internal Hueguard scheduler, which enforces per-team quotas. All requests to the scheduler must be authenticated, and the key to use for release audits appears below.

gateway credential: kto3_qfe

## Idempotency Keys for Payment Retries (Lumopay)

Every retry of a charge request must reuse the original idempotency key; generating a new key on retry can produce duplicate charges. Keys are scoped per merchant and expire after 48 hours. Reviewers should verify keys are derived server-side, never from client input. The full key-generation specification and threat model are maintained on the internal page.

dashboard of kaguf-tawip = https://vault.merlaqsys.test/issue

Handover Note — Logistics Provider Change

Hi all — as I hand over to Priya Ostwell, a quick recap for branch managers. We're moving from Carthall Freight to Merrow Logistics from 1 November. Expect a two-week overlap; keep both booking systems live until then. Delivery windows shift to morning slots in rural branches. Priya will run the transition calls. The wider rationale is covered in the confidential note just below.

board note of bawep-tajef: Queniusek Systems plans to raise the Quenvan list price by 53.1 percent in March. The pricing group signed off on a budget of $176.4 million for Project Drueth. The renewal with Casionix Partners closes at $142.5 million a year, 8.3 percent below the last contract. Project Fraax slips by six weeks because of the tooling delay.